(a) What is the intensity in W/m2 of a laser beam used to burn away cancerous tissue that, when 90.0% absorbed, puts 500 J of energy into a circular spot 2.00 mm in diameter in 4.00 s? (b) Discuss how this intensity compares to the average intensity of sunlight (about 700W/m2 ) and the implications that would have if the laser beam entered your eye. Note how the amount of damage depends on the time duration of the exposure.
